Cherokee city, KS

Quick answer

Cherokee city has 692 residents, ranking #252 of 740 places in Kansas. Median household income is $47,778, the median home is worth $81,800 and median gross rent runs $754 a month.

What the numbers mean in Cherokee city

Housing cost measured against local earnings.

A household earning the Cherokee city median would spend about 18.9% of gross income on the median rent. The 30% mark is the federal threshold for cost burden, so anything above it signals a stretched rental market. The median home costs 1.7× the median household income; nationally that ratio sits near 4.5×. Poverty affects 12% of residents and 77.2% of households own their home.

Source: US Census Bureau, ACS 2019-2023 5-year estimates · rates as published for 2019-2023 ACS 5-year
